Abstract

Energy, due to its increasing usage in various broad areas has been maintained as a vital factor in economic growth and development of societies. Meanwhile, natural gas is considered as one of the most important energy sources. Therefore, the efficiency and the productivity of the gas companies are crucial to be assessed. Numerous examples from industrial multistage processes including internal structures exist, such as petrochemical industry, perfume manufacturing, etc. Despite the fact that internal structures are not considered in conventional DEA, they are being taken into account in Network DEA. An evaluation of efficiency via Network DEA has been conducted in Iranian gas companies during 2002-2004 and the results are discussed in the following pages. After acquiring companies’ efficiency scores, we ranked them through Cross Efficiency (CE) technique thoroughly. Ultimately, we indicated the effectiveness of each input /output selected factors in efficiency measurement.
